Our effort Defensively vs Hull was the best I’ve seen since Wane left.
- great intensity
- great line speed
- great sliding / scrambling
Excellent effort from Isa, Smithies, Powell and Byrne.
Attack however, we still look so so clueless. Very flat, very laboured, no ideas, no creativity, no running at speed and shifting it.
